项目简介
本项目是一个基于端口复用技术的反向Shell通信服务端程序。借助注入技术,服务端能够在目标进程的地址空间中执行自定义代码,进而实现文件传输、命令执行等功能,旨在为用户提供安全、高效的通信工具,辅助用户远程管理和控制目标系统。
项目的主要特性和功能
- 文件传输:支持向目标系统上传和下载文件。
- 命令执行:可远程执行目标系统上的命令。
- 加密通信:采用AES加密技术保障通信安全。
- 系统兼容性:支持Linux和Windows等多种操作系统。
- 可定制性:用户能按需自定义部分功能或行为。
安装使用步骤
服务器端(Linux)
- 编译注入代码:使用合适的编译器编译
injectme.c
等注入代码文件,确保有执行操作的权限。 - 运行服务器端程序:运行编译后的服务器端程序,按需配置端口及其他参数,运行前检查并理解所有配置选项的含义和用途。
- 配置防火墙:按需配置防火墙规则,允许外部访问指定端口,确保只有受信任的用户可访问服务器。
客户端(Windows 或 Linux)
- 编译客户端程序:使用合适的编译器编译客户端程序(如
ReverseShell.cpp
),确保有编译C++代码的开发环境和工具链。 - 运行客户端程序:运行客户端程序,连接到服务器端的IP地址和端口,可能需提供服务器的密码或其他认证信息来建立连接。
- 执行操作:连接建立后,可使用客户端程序执行文件传输、命令执行等操作,注意这些操作可能影响目标系统,需谨慎使用。
注意事项
- 遵守相关法律法规,不得用于非法活动。
- 谨慎使用远程控制功能,避免对目标系统造成不良影响。
- 使用任何功能前,确保理解其含义和潜在风险。
- 确保服务器的安全性和稳定性,保障数据传输安全。
- 定期更新和维护项目,保证其正常运行和安全性。
下载地址
点击下载 【提取码: 4003】【解压密码: www.makuang.net】